Establishing Robust Naming Conventions
Naming conventions serve as the first line of organization in any document management system, and in VDRs they become even more critical because filenames often appear in audit logs, permission reports, and search results without full context. A well-designed naming convention should immediately communicate what the document contains, when it was created or relevant to, and its version status without requiring users to open the file. The most effective VDR naming conventions follow a structured format such as YYYYMMDD_Category_Description_vX pattern, where dates use ISO format for proper sorting, categories use standardized abbreviations, descriptions avoid special characters, and version numbers prevent confusion between drafts and final documents. For example, 20260215_FIN_Q4-Financial-Statements_v3.pdf instantly tells users this is a financial document from February 2026 in its third revision. Avoid generic names like final.pdf or document1.docx that provide zero context in search results or audit trails.
Critical Elements of Effective File Naming
Every filename in your VDR should include date prefixes in YYYYMMDD format because this ensures chronological sorting across all operating systems and platforms, making it easy to identify the most recent versions or relevant time periods at a glance. Category codes should be limited to 3-4 letter abbreviations that your team standardizes across all projects such as FIN for financial, LEG for legal, HR for human resources, OPS for operations, and IP for intellectual property. The description portion should use hyphens or underscores instead of spaces, limit length to 50 characters maximum, avoid special characters that cause encoding issues, and include enough specificity to differentiate similar documents like Board-Meeting-Minutes versus Shareholder-Meeting-Minutes. Version control suffixes should follow _v1, _v2, _v3 format rather than _final or _final2 because final is rarely actually final in business contexts, and numbered versions create clear progression that everyone understands regardless of their role or industry background.
Designing Optimal Folder Hierarchies
Folder structure in a virtual data room must balance depth with accessibility, creating enough categorization to organize thousands of documents while avoiding nested hierarchies so deep that users get lost or frustrated trying to navigate to relevant files. Research shows that folder structures exceeding five levels deep significantly increase user abandonment and support requests, while structures with fewer than three levels fail to provide adequate organization for complex transactions. The optimal approach typically implements four levels: Level 1 for major functional areas like Financial, Legal, Operations, and Human Resources; Level 2 for document types within each area such as Statements, Contracts, Policies; Level 3 for time periods or specific subtopics like 2024, 2025, 2026 or Leases, Licenses, Agreements; and Level 4 for granular categories only when absolutely necessary. This structure allows users to drill down intuitively while keeping any document within three or four clicks of the root directory.
When designing your folder hierarchy, resist the temptation to replicate your internal file server structure because external users conducting due diligence need a more intuitive, transaction-focused organization rather than your company's internal departmental silos. Instead, organize folders around the questions external parties will ask or the categories they expect to see in standard due diligence checklists. For M&A transactions, this typically means top-level folders for Corporate, Financial, Commercial, Legal, IP, HR, IT, Real Estate, and Environmental with consistent subfolders under each that mirror what acquirers expect. Maintain parallel folder structures across all sections so users learn the navigation pattern once and can apply it throughout the VDR, and avoid creating single-document folders that add unnecessary clicks without organizational value.
| Folder Level | Purpose | Example | Best Practice |
|---|---|---|---|
| Level 1 | Major functional areas | 01_Financial, 02_Legal, 03_Operations | Use numbered prefixes for forced sorting order |
| Level 2 | Document categories | Financial-Statements, Tax-Returns, Audits | Limit to 8-12 folders per parent to avoid overwhelm |
| Level 3 | Time periods or subtypes | 2024, 2025, 2026 or Annual, Quarterly, Monthly | Use consistent chronological or alphabetical logic |
| Level 4 | Granular subcategories | Q1, Q2, Q3, Q4 or Internal, External, Draft | Only create when necessary for 50+ documents in Level 3 |
Implementing Comprehensive Metadata Tagging
Essential Metadata Fields for VDR Documents
Metadata transforms virtual data rooms from simple file repositories into intelligent information systems that enable sophisticated search, filtering, and reporting capabilities that folder structures alone cannot provide. Every document uploaded to your VDR should include standardized metadata fields that capture document type, creation date, relevant time period, confidentiality level, responsible party, review status, and business unit or project association. The key is establishing your metadata taxonomy before uploading documents and training all contributors to apply tags consistently rather than treating metadata as an afterthought or optional enhancement.
- Document Type: Standardized categories like Contract, Report, Statement, Policy, Correspondence, Presentation that enable filtering by format and purpose
- Date Fields: Separate tags for Creation Date, Effective Date, Expiration Date, and Review Date to support time-based searches and automated alerts
- Confidentiality Level: Clear classifications like Public, Internal, Confidential, Highly Confidential that integrate with permission settings and watermarking
- Status Indicators: Tags for Draft, Under Review, Approved, Executed, Archived that communicate document maturity and reliability
- Business Context: Custom fields for Project Name, Transaction Phase, Responsible Department, Geographic Region, or Product Line relevant to your industry
- Keyword Tags: Flexible free-text or controlled vocabulary terms that capture concepts, parties, or topics not covered by structured fields
Frequently Asked Questions
How many folders should a well-organized VDR contain?
A well-organized VDR typically contains between 50-150 folders depending on transaction complexity, with most falling in the 75-100 range. The exact number matters less than maintaining consistent hierarchy depth and ensuring no single folder contains more than 50 documents. If you find yourself creating 200+ folders, you likely have too much granularity and should consolidate, while fewer than 40 folders often indicates insufficient organization for complex due diligence.
Should we use metadata or folder structure as our primary organization method?
Use both in complementary ways rather than choosing one over the other. Folder structure provides intuitive navigation for users browsing the VDR, while metadata enables powerful search and filtering for users who know exactly what they need. The folder hierarchy should reflect how documents naturally cluster by function and type, while metadata captures cross-cutting dimensions like date ranges, confidentiality levels, and status that don't fit neatly into a single folder path.
What are the most common document management mistakes in virtual data rooms?
The five most frequent mistakes are: inconsistent naming conventions where different team members follow different formats, folder structures that exceed five levels deep making navigation tedious, failing to remove or clearly mark outdated document versions leading to confusion about which version is current, insufficient metadata tagging that makes search functionality nearly useless, and creating duplicate folders with similar names like Contracts and Agreements that cause users to miss relevant documents. Establishing clear standards upfront and conducting quality audits prevents these issues.
